Mailinglisten-Archive |
Hi loide,
seit einigen stunden beschäftige ich mich schon mit einem etwas
komplexeren thema und sehe so langsam den wald vor lauter bäumen nicht
mehr. Vielleicht hat hier jemand eine idee und/oder einen tip.
Es geht um folgendes:
In tabelle "autos" sind die verschiedenen modelle eines autos
enthalten:
+----+---------------+---------+---------+
| id | modell | vorwahl | PLZ |
+----+---------------+---------+---------+
| 1 | Mercedes 230 | 040 | 20532 |
| 2 | Mercedes 240 | 040 | 22532 |
| 3 | Mazda 323 | 040 | 22765 |
| 4 | Honda Prelude | 0521 | 33520 |
| 5 | Fiat Panda | 05221 | 34520 |
+----+---------------+---------+---------+
In einer zweiten tabelle ("auto_prop") sind nun die eigenschaften
dieser autos enthalten:
+---------+---------+
| auto_id |property |
+---------+---------+
| 1 | rot |
| 2 | rot |
| 3 | blau |
| 3 | ZF |
| 4 | ABS |
| 4 | rot |
| 5 | ABS |
| 5 | EFH |
| 5 | AC |
| 5 | gelb |
+---------+---------+
Wie bekomme ich nun mit je einem sql-statement alle roten autos mit
ABS, oder alle gelben mit ABS und AC oder alle blauen autos aus
Hamburg (vorwahl=040)? Btw: für ein auto können bis zu neun
eigenschaften definiert werden (vorgabe der anwendung).
Mit mehreren sql-statements bekomme ich es hin, doch mit einem
einzigen will es nicht gelingen. Wenn also jemand eine idee hat, bin
ich sehr dankbar!
ciao
amalesh
--
Anwendungsentwicklung mit C++ JAVA VB PHP ASP SQL POET SGML XML
http://www.living-source.com ~ ak_(at)_living-source.com ~ icq963380
Hamburg : Tel. 040-39834630 Fax. 040-39834639 Mob. 0170-4809618
Freiburg: Tel. 0761-152580 Fax. 0761-1525850
---
*** Abmelden von dieser Mailingliste funktioniert per E-Mail
*** an mysql-de-request_(at)_lists.4t2.com mit Betreff/Subject: unsubscribe
php::bar PHP Wiki - Listenarchive